Up for auction is an original NOS Head gasket for the Hercules JXD motor. This was used in the White M3A1 Scout Cars, M8 and M20 Ford Armored cars, Studebaker 2 1/2 ton trucks, and many searchlight units. This is a NOS gasket and works great! I just put one on my Scout Car. Good Luck Bidding!

Battery breakthrough set to accelerate electric-car development
Thu, 12 Mar 2009A team of scientists working at the Massachusetts Institute of Technology are claiming a significant breakthrough in recharging times for lithium-ion batteries. According to findings published in the scientific journal Nature, MIT researchers Byoungwoo Kang and Gerbrand Ceder have unlocked the potential of lithium-ion batteries by patenting a unique process which is claimed to allow a typical laptop power pack to be fully recharged in less than a minute--an improvement in recharging performance of roughly 90 percent over existing lithium-ion batteries. Lithium-ion batteries generate electric current via the flow of lithium ions across an electrolyte, from an electrode to a cathode.
